Pythonはその豊富なライブラリとAPIにより、PDFからテキストを抽出するための強力なツールとなります。この記事では、Pythonを使用してPDFからテキストを抽出する方法を紹介します。
pdfminer.sixを使用したテキスト抽出
pdfminer.sixはPDFファイルからテキスト情報を抽出する機能を有するPythonモジュールです。以下にその使用方法を示します。
!pip install pdfminer.six
import pdfminer
pdfminer.sixのGitHubから公開されているコード「pdf2txt.py」を作業ディレクトリに持ってきます。その後、以下のコマンドでテキストを抽出します。
!python pdf2txt.py sample1.pdf
PyPDF2を使用したテキスト抽出
PyPDF2もまた、PDFからテキストを抽出するためのPythonライブラリです。以下にその使用方法を示します。
from PyPDF2 import PdfReader
reader = PdfReader("a.pdf")
page = reader.pages
print(page.extract_text())
- これらのライブラリを使用することで、Pythonを用いてPDFからテキストを効率的に抽出することが可能となります。具体的な使用例や詳細な情報については、各ライブラリの公式ドキュメンテーションをご覧ください。